Any meal with animal protein is meant to be fully consumed in 4-5 days. We handle your food thoughtfully, keeping timing and temperature in consideration. Meals that you would like frozen should be moved to the freezer, when fully fridge-cold, on day 1 (not day 4/5). A general rule of thumb is to consider any time outside of “fridge temperature” to be like a clock. Health code considers 4 hours outside of this range of cold temperature to be unsafe. If you have questions about food handling, please let us know.
(Don’t leave fish on the counter all day and then eat it…we can guarantee you won’t feel well.)
